/// Object for passing options to the compiler.
class CompilerOptions {
+ /// The entry point of the application that is being compiled.
final Uri entryPoint;
+
+ /// Root location where SDK libraries are found.
final Uri libraryRoot;
+
+ /// Package root location.
+ ///
+ /// if not null then [packageConfig] should be null.

+String _extractStringOption(
+ List<String> options, String prefix, String defaultValue) {
+ for (String option in options) {
+ if (option.startsWith(prefix)) {
+ return option.substring(prefix.length);
+ }
+ }
+ return defaultValue;
+}
+
+Uri _extractUriOption(List<String> options, String prefix) {
+ var option = _extractStringOption(options, prefix, null);
+ return (option == null) ? null : Uri.parse(option);
+}
+
+// CSV: Comma separated values.
+List<String> _extractCsvOption(List<String> options, String prefix) {
+ for (String option in options) {
+ if (option.startsWith(prefix)) {
+ return option.substring(prefix.length).split(',');
+ }
+ }
+ return const <String>[];
+}
+
+/// Extract list of comma separated values provided for [flag]. Returns an
+/// empty list if [option] contain [flag] without arguments. Returns `null` if
+/// [option] doesn't contain [flag] with or without arguments.
+List<String> _extractOptionalCsvOption(List<String> options, String flag) {
+ String prefix = '$flag=';
+ for (String option in options) {
+ if (option == flag) {
+ return const <String>[];
+ }
+ if (option.startsWith(flag)) {
+ return option.substring(prefix.length).split(',');
+ }
+ }
+ return null;
+}
+
+Uri _resolvePlatformConfigFromOptions(Uri libraryRoot, List<String> options) {
+ return _resolvePlatformConfig(libraryRoot,
+ _extractStringOption(options, "--platform-config=", null),
+ _hasOption(options, '--output-type=dart'),
+ _extractCsvOption(options, '--categories='));
+}
+
+Uri _resolvePlatformConfig(Uri libraryRoot,
+ String platformConfigPath, bool isDart2Dart, Iterable<String> categories) {
+ if (platformConfigPath != null) {
+ return libraryRoot.resolve(platformConfigPath);
+ } else if (isDart2Dart) {
+ return libraryRoot.resolve(_dart2dartPlatform);
+ } else {
+ if (categories.length == 0) {
+ return libraryRoot.resolve(_clientPlatform);
+ }
+ assert(categories.length <= 2);
+ if (categories.contains("Client")) {
+ if (categories.contains("Server")) {
+ return libraryRoot.resolve(_sharedPlatform);
+ }
+ return libraryRoot.resolve(_clientPlatform);
+ }
+ assert(categories.contains("Server"));
+ return libraryRoot.resolve(_serverPlatform);
+ }
+}
+
+bool _hasOption(List<String> options, String option) {
+ return options.indexOf(option) >= 0;
+}
+
+/// Locations of the platform descriptor files relative to the library root.
+const String _clientPlatform = "lib/dart_client.platform";
+const String _serverPlatform = "lib/dart_server.platform";
+const String _sharedPlatform = "lib/dart_shared.platform";
+const String _dart2dartPlatform = "lib/dart2dart.platform";
+
+const String _UNDETERMINED_BUILD_ID = "build number could not be determined";
+const bool _forceIncrementalSupport =
+ const bool.fromEnvironment('DART2JS_EXPERIMENTAL_INCREMENTAL_SUPPORT');
